Meta’s next AI play are chatbots called personas
in which three people with inside knowledge on the matter have confirmed that Zuckerberg and co. want to launch a range of AI chatbots across many Meta-owned platforms called personas.
“The company has explored launching one that speaks like Abraham Lincoln and another that advises on travel options in the style of a surfer, according to a person with knowledge of the plans,” wrote the Financial Times.
